Transaction 77df0c83c10a60f6bf21647a602e8bcb53421b4577448fa5f778cf6ea76be043
1 Input
1 Output
-
77df0c83c10a60f6bf21647a602e8bcb53421b4577448fa5f778cf6ea76be043:0
- value
- 4581507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58c9cd0e3e87840b85150f80fdafdbd5cdfbc016 OP_EQUAL
- address
- 39nV8oazY5kdvqHNcrSAUjxzXQSxr5W9Q1